JOB SUMMARY

The Vice President of Finance Technology and Integration will be be a critical member of the finance leadership team responsible for defining and executing the enterprise's 5-year finance IT strategy and leading all finance-related integration activities for affiliations. The incumbent acts as a strategic visionary with a deep understanding of finance processes and technology, capable of driving transformation and ensuring seamless integration of financial systems and processes.

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Finance IT Strategy & Stakeholder Relationships

    • Develop, articulate, and execute a comprehensive 5-year technology strategy for the finance organization that aligns with the enterprise's strategic goals.

    • Partner with IT, business leaders, and business unit finance to translate business needs into technology solutions and create a roadmap for the evolution of our finance systems, including ERP, financial planning & analysis (FP&A), and reporting platforms.

    • Oversee the selection, prioritization, implementation, and optimization of all financial systems and technologies.

    • Manage relationships with key technology vendors and consulting partners.

    • Stay up to date on the latest finance technology trends and best practices.

  • Finance IT Execution & Compliance

    • Direct the development, requirements-gathering, business process mapping, data conversion, systems configuration, testing, deployment, documentation, and updates for all Finance systems.

    • Lead the development, testing, implementation/adoption, and scaling of AI use cases for finance with appropriate governance.

    • Develop and track key performance indicators to assess achievement of goals, milestones, and efficiency/productivity.

    • Drive a culture of continuous improvement, identifying opportunities to automate processes, enhance data analytics, and improve efficiency within the finance function.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to drive finance transformation initiatives.

    • Ensure the integrity, security, and accuracy of all financial systems and data.

    • Ensure compliance with all relevant laws, regulations, and standards related to finance technology and data privacy.

  • Finance Integration of Affiliations:

    • Lead the finance integration workstream for all strategic affiliations from due diligence through post-affiliation integration.

    • Develop and implement a scalable and repeatable playbook for finance integration to ensure consistency and efficiency.

    • Direct the integration of financial reporting, planning, accounting policies, and internal controls for acquired entities.

    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(e.g., Corporate Development, HR, Legal, IT) to ensure a holistic and successful integration process.

    • Oversee the integration of financial systems, ensuring a smooth transition and data migration.

    • Provide regular updates to the executive leadership team on integration progress, risks, and synergies.

We are a national, blended health organization, passionately delivering on our mission: To create a remarkable health experience, freeing people to be their best. We're 44,000 employees strong — and proud to be serving millions of customers across the U.S. every day. Headquartered in Pittsburgh, we're regionally focused in Pennsylvania, Delaware, West Virginia, and New York, with customers in all 50 states and the District of Columbia. We passionately serve individual consumers and fellow businesses alike. Our companies cover a diversified spectrum of essential health-related needs, including health insurance, health care delivery, population health management, dental solutions, reinsurance solutions, and innovative technology solutions. We're also proud to carry forth an important legacy of compassionate care and philanthropy that began more than 175 years ago. This tradition of giving back, reinvesting and ensuring that our communities remain strong and healthy is deeply embedded in our culture, informing our decisions every day.

Highmark Health was established in Pittsburgh in 2013 to ensure delivery of health care at the right time, at the right place, and at the right cost to customers through our diverse portfolio of health care-related businesses. The parent company of Highmark Inc., Allegheny Health Network, and enGen (formerly HM Health Solutions), Highmark Health today leads a national health and wellness enterprise that also ranks as America's third largest integrated health care delivery and financing system. While Highmark Health as an enterprise is relatively new, some of our affiliates and their predecessors have a proud legacy of providing health care in their communities for more than 175 years. Our financial position reflects stability, with our year-end 2023 consolidated revenues totaling $27.1 billion.
